About Sajini

Mr S. Sajini is a man from the East Rand — born and bred. His humble beginnings started at Nancy McDowell's crèche in Daveyton, where virtues sustained at home by his mom and dad shaped the educator he would become. Pre-school at Tiny Crystals (Crystal Park Primary) gave him his good command of the English language. Watching his mother — herself an educator — at work, he caught the teaching bug early. When adults asked what he wanted to be, his answer never wavered: "a principal of a school."

From Arbor Primary — "The Best On The East Rand" — to Benoni High School, where he matriculated with a Bachelor's Degree pass, Mr Sajini then enrolled at the University of Johannesburg (Kingsway Campus, Faculty of Education) for his B.Ed. In 2015 the dream came true: he began teaching at a high school. Over 11 years he has taught across the commerce stream — Business Studies, Economics and EMS — and today his focus and passion is Afrikaans (First Additional Language): Taal, Begrip & Letterkunde, and Mondeling & Skryf. The mission stays the same — turn struggle into distinctions. Through God's grace, he continues to excel and aim higher.

Afrikaans FAL — Taal & Grammatika

Sentence structure, word order, tenses and the ten language rules examiners chase every November. Drilled the way Mr Sajini teaches it in class — until learners stop guessing.

Afrikaans FAL — Begrip & Letterkunde

Comprehension, summary, poetry and the prescribed novels/dramas. Mr Sajini breaks down the set-works learners actually face in Paper 2.

Afrikaans FAL — Mondeling & Skryf

Prepared and unprepared orals, transactional and creative writing. Confidence-first coaching so the spoken and written marks both lift.
